WebApr 12, 2024 · The final stage of periodontal disease occurs when the periodontal infection deepens even further. You are now at a 50% – 90% risk of loss of bone. Along with bone loss, advanced periodontitis causes red, inflamed gums that ooze pus, a feeling of cold sensitivity, further loosening of teeth, painful chewing, and severe bad breath. WebYour periodontist may recommend a regenerative procedure when the bone supporting your teeth has been destroyed due to periodontal disease. These procedures can reverse some of the damage by regenerating lost bone and tissue. During this procedure, your periodontist folds back the gum tissue and removes the disease-causing bacteria.
